Hi Dave,

I strongly suspect .NET pins function parameters for you when there is a need to do so, of course only for as long as the native function is being called. This applies to:
- strings you pass to a const char*
- StringBuilders you pass to a char*
- delegates you pass to a function pointer
- etc.etc.

I have been doing this all along. I only use GCHandle to explicitly pin down things that need to remain natively in use after the native function returns, such as buffers that will be used asynchronously.

I've never used Marshal.GetFunctionPointerForDelegate(); I suspect the only real use for it is when a delegate is buried inside a larger structure. Same seems to apply for a lot of stuff in the Marshal class.
